I was just about to say yes please but apparently it doesn't work with Mac OS Sierra or Linux due to needing custom drivers

vinyljunky
02-06-2017, 16:40
You can download the drivers off the m2tech website that's what I did


Sent from my iPhone using Tapatalk

guyb
02-06-2017, 16:43
I could only see drivers for Mavericks and doing a search suggested there were no drivers due to issues. Also, I plan to run ROCK by Roon soon which is a variant of Linux and only works with DACs that don't need custom drivers

alcarmichael
02-06-2017, 16:53
Yeah this is correct, the latest MAC OS aren't compatible with the M2Tech drivers. Which is a great shame for MAC users as it's an outstanding DAC.
